Boot Scooters: The Basics

A boot scooter, also known as a car boot scooter or a portable mobility scooter, is a compact and lightweight mobility device designed for easy transport. Boot mobility scooters fit into the boot of your car, making them perfect for day trips, weekends away, or simply getting around shopping centres and other indoor environments.

Key Features of Boot Scooters

Here are the key features that distinguish boot mobility scooters from larger road-legal models:

  • Compact and lightweight: These scooters are generally smaller and lighter than their full-sized counterparts.
  • Easy disassembly: A boot scooter can either fold up or disassemble into smaller, lighter parts. This can be done with minimal effort, often requiring just a few simple steps. 
  • Battery-powered: Like standard scooters, boot mobility scooters are powered by a rechargeable battery.
  • Speed and range: Boot scooters typically have a maximum speed of around 4mph, which is the legal limit in the UK for most pavements and indoor environments. Their range can vary, but many offer a sufficient distance for day-to-day use between 6 and 30 miles per charge.

Types of Boot Scooters

There are two main types of boot mobility scooters:

Folding Mobility Scooters

As the name suggests, these scooters fold up for easy storage and transportation, often resembling a small suitcase. Folding scooters are usually lighter and more compact than other types of boot scooters, making them a good choice for those with limited storage space. 

Dismantling Scooters

These scooters can be taken apart into 4 or 5 pieces, making them easy to load into the boot of a car. Each part is typically light in weight, ensuring easy handling. Whilst dismantling scooters are usually heavier overall than folding scooters, their individual pieces are significantly lighter making them a popular choice for people who can only lift a small amount at once. 

 

Benefits of Boot Mobility Scooters

Boot mobility scooters offer numerous benefits that make them a popular choice among users:

  • Portability and convenience: The primary advantages of a boot scooter are its smaller size, lightweight construction, and portability. Whether you’re travelling by car, bus, or train, these scooters can be easily transported wherever you go.
  • Versatility: Suitable for both indoor and outdoor use, these mobility scooters are perfect for navigating shopping centres, parks, and other public spaces.
  • Easy storage: When not in use, boot scooters can be easily stored in small spaces, making them an excellent choice for those with limited storage options.
  • Cost-effectiveness: They usually come at a lower price point than larger mobility scooters.

 

Popular Boot Mobility Scooter Models

A wide range of boot scooters are available in the UK. These are just a few examples of popular models from trusted brands:

eFOLDi Lite

The eFOLDi Lite is one of the lightest folding mobility scooters on the market. Its magnesium alloy frame weighs just 15kg and boasts an extremely quick folding mechanism. The eFOLDi Lite folds to the size of a small suitcase. 

Pride Apex Lite and Pride Apex Rapid

These are two easily transportable 4mph scooters from Pride Mobility Ltd.

  • The Pride Apex Lite is a classic style disassembling boot scooter that fits comfortably into most car boots. It’s perfect for those looking for easy handling and manoeuvring.
  • The Pride Apex Rapid has similar benefits but is known for its Comfort-Trac Suspension (CTS), which offers a smoother ride on rough surfaces, LED headlight, ergonomic handlebars and many other features. 

Pride GoGo Elite Traveller Plus

This model is a favourite among those who need a compact scooter with a higher weight capacity. It has a delta tiller, non-scuffing tyres, and stylish design. Overall, the GoGo Elite Traveller Plus provides a great balance of performance and portability, with a weight capacity over 23 stone. 

 

Is a Boot Scooter Right for You?

Here are some questions to help you decide whether a boot scooter is right for you:

  • Do you enjoy driving and want to take your mobility scooter on outings?
      • Boot mobility scooters are easy to store in a car boot, ideal for maintaining an active lifestyle.
  • Are you looking for a scooter for short journeys around town or shopping trips?
      • Boot scooters are restricted to pavements and have a speed limit of 4 mph, making them perfect for shorter distances and everyday environments.
  • Do you have limited storage space at home?
      • These compact scooters can be easily disassembled or folded, taking up minimal space indoors.
  • Can you comfortably dismantle or fold the scooter?
    • Consider if you can manage the folding or dismantling process or if you’ll need assistance.

 

If you answered yes to most of these questions, a boot scooter could be a great choice. However, for longer journeys, higher speeds, or road use, a larger road scooter might be a better option.
